Van Wezel's Bensel Receives Congressional Honor
Van Wezel's Bensel Receives Congressional Honor
January 24, 2011

At the Van Wezel Foundation's 10th annual Gala last evening, the Honorable Congressman, Vern Buchanan presented Mary Bensel, Executive Director of the Van Wezel Performing Arts Hall, a congressional proclamation in honor of her service and leadership of the Hall and in support of the educational programs and community engagement activities of the Hall. The gala and the show, which featured Dionne Warwick, were sell outs. Congressman Buchanan stated that the Van Wezel is a driving force in Sarasota's vibrant art scene, which is a major economic driver for the area.

Former NY Giant Carl Banks To Sign Autographs At LOMBARDI 2/1
Former NY Giant Carl Banks To Sign Autographs At LOMBARDI 2/1
January 24, 2011

Former New York Giants linebacker Carl Banks will be signing autographs in the lower lobby of the Circle in the Square Theatre on Tuesday, February 1 from 6:30-7:00pm. The 1986 Vince Lombardi trophy that Banks and the rest of the 'Big Blue Wrecking Crew' helped to bring home to New York for their victory in Super Bowl XXI will also be on display from February 1 through Super Bowl Sunday on February 6, 2011. The lower lobby of the Circle in the Square Theatre is accessible to ticket-holders only.

Bay Street Players Hold THE RITZ Auditions 2/7-8
Bay Street Players Hold THE RITZ Auditions 2/7-8
January 24, 2011

Bay Street Players will hold auditions for Terrance McNally's The Ritz on Monday, February 7th and Tuesday, February 8th at 7:30PM at 109 N. Bay Street, Eustis. No appointment is necessary. This farce is set in a men's Manhattan bathhouse where an unsuspecting businessman has taken refuge from his homicidal mobster brother-in-law and stumbles across an assortment of oddball characters. Confusion and complications multiply.

Broadway Comic Actor Jay Garner Dead At 82
Broadway Comic Actor Jay Garner Dead At 82
January 24, 2011

Jay Garner, a veteran actor of the stage and screen, passed away Jan. 21 at the age of 82. Mr. Garner died in New York City of respiratory failure resulting from pneumonia, according to friend and La Cage castmate John Weiner.
